Auxiliary Marine Engine Market

Auxiliary Marine Engine Market

The Auxiliary Marine Engine Market is an integral segment of the maritime industry, providing essential power for a ship's onboard systems beyond propulsion. These engines run generators for electricity, drive pumps, compressors, winches, and other auxiliary equipment that ensure the smooth functioning of vessels. As the global shipping industry embraces digitalization, decarbonization, and automation, auxiliary marine engines are evolving to become more efficient, compact, and environmentally compliant.

Market Drivers: Vessel Electrification and Operational Efficiency

The primary driver of the auxiliary marine engine market is the growing demand for reliable onboard power generation. In commercial ships, naval vessels, cruise liners, and offshore support vessels, auxiliary engines ensure the continuous operation of critical systems such as lighting, navigation, HVAC, refrigeration, and communications.

With rising international trade and maritime activity, particularly in container shipping, offshore energy, and cruise tourism, the need for auxiliary engines is growing in line with new shipbuilding and fleet modernization projects.

Furthermore, emission regulations from the International Maritime Organization (IMO) and national authorities are pushing shipowners to replace older auxiliary engines with low-emission or dual-fuel alternatives. Operators are also looking to reduce fuel consumption during idle or port operations, where auxiliary engines typically operate continuously. This makes fuel-efficient and hybrid-ready auxiliary engines more appealing.

Technological Advancements: Hybrid Systems and Emission Control

Auxiliary engine manufacturers are embracing advanced technologies to meet the maritime sector's evolving demands. One of the key trends is the development of hybrid auxiliary power systems, which combine conventional engines with batteries or shore power integration. These systems significantly reduce fuel usage and emissions when ships are docked or operating at low loads.

Additionally, innovations in engine management systems, exhaust gas after-treatment (such as SCR and scrubbers), and digital monitoring are helping operators improve performance while meeting Tier III NOx and SOx emission standards.

Modern auxiliary marine engines are now built to be more compact, easier to maintain, and digitally connected, offering predictive maintenance alerts and operational data analytics. This shift toward smarter engines supports the broader trend of digital transformation in maritime operations.

Regional Insights: Asia-Pacific Leads, Europe and North America Modernize

The Asia-Pacific region dominates the auxiliary marine engine market, driven by large-scale shipbuilding activities in countries like China, South Korea, and Japan. These countries account for the bulk of global commercial vessel production and export, fueling demand for both main and auxiliary engines.

Europe is seeing strong demand for advanced auxiliary engines in cruise ships, offshore vessels, and naval fleets, especially with the region's push for clean shipping and sustainability. Countries like Germany, Norway, and Italy are investing in hybrid auxiliary power systems and shore power compatibility for docked vessels.

North America is a growing market, driven by investments in port electrification, inland waterways, and retrofits for emission compliance. The U.S. and Canada are also seeing increased adoption of alternative fuels like LNG and methanol in auxiliary systems.
